Nettet745 ILCS 10/1-210. (745 ILCS 10/1-210) (from Ch. 85, par. 1-210) Sec. 1-210. "Willful and wanton conduct" as used in this Act means a course of action which shows an actual or deliberate intention to cause harm or which, if not intentional, shows an utter indifference to or conscious disregard for the safety of others or their property.
